The MAX608EPA from Maxim Integrated is a high-efficiency, step-up DC-DC voltage converter designed to provide a reliable power solution for applications requiring voltage boost functionality. This component is particularly well-suited for portable devices, where efficient power conversion is essential for prolonged battery life and consistent performance.
Key Features
- Input Voltage Range: The MAX608EPA operates with an input voltage range of 1.8V to 11V, making it versatile for various low-voltage sources, including single-cell batteries.
- Adjustable Output Voltage: It offers an adjustable output voltage up to 27.5V, which can be set by external resistors, providing flexibility for different circuit requirements.
- High Efficiency: With efficiencies up to 87%, this voltage converter minimizes energy loss, ensuring more power is delivered to the load.
- Low Quiescent Current: The low quiescent current of 110µA (typical) extends battery life, which is critical for portable applications.
- Shutdown Mode: It includes a shutdown mode that reduces the supply current to 5µA (typical), further conserving power when the device is not in use.
